The automotive industry has undergone significant advancements over the years, particularly in the realm of braking systems. One such innovation is the multiple disc brake, which has gained popularity for its efficiency and reliability. Understanding how this system works and its advantages can help consumers make informed decisions when purchasing vehicles. A multiple disc brake system consists of several friction discs that are stacked together within a housing. When the driver presses the brake pedal, hydraulic pressure is applied, causing the discs to clamp together and create friction against the brake pads. This action slows down or stops the vehicle effectively. The design allows for greater surface area contact, which results in improved braking performance compared to traditional single-disc systems. One of the key benefits of a multiple disc brake system is its ability to dissipate heat more efficiently. During heavy braking, heat builds up in the braking system, which can lead to brake fade—a reduction in braking effectiveness due to overheating. However, because the multiple disc brake has multiple discs, it spreads the heat across a larger area, reducing the risk of fade and maintaining consistent performance. This makes it particularly advantageous for high-performance vehicles or those used in racing scenarios. Moreover, the compact design of the multiple disc brake system allows for lighter weight components, which can contribute to overall vehicle performance. Lighter brakes mean less unsprung weight, enhancing the vehicle's handling and responsiveness. As a result, many manufacturers are opting for multiple disc brake systems in their sports cars and motorcycles, where performance is paramount. In addition to performance benefits, multiple disc brake systems also offer enhanced durability. The materials used in the construction of these brakes are often designed to withstand high levels of stress and wear, leading to longer service life. This durability not only reduces maintenance costs but also enhances safety, as drivers can rely on their brakes to perform consistently over time. However, it is important to note that while multiple disc brake systems have numerous advantages, they can also come with some drawbacks. For instance, they tend to be more expensive than traditional braking systems due to their complex design and the materials used. Additionally, repairs and replacements can also be costlier, which may deter some consumers from choosing vehicles equipped with this technology.
